Plan Commission To Hold Public Hearing On Requested Zoning For Business

Last updated on Wednesday, September 4, 2013

(BEDFORD) - Mandy Hazen might still be able to open a business at 827 R Street but the zoning will have to be changed before that happens.

Hazen is buying property on contract from Fred Herthel. The property includes a home at the intersection of R Street and John Williams Boulevard where Hazen plans to open Pinky's Garage Kustom Klothing and Kulture.

The property is zoned for residential use. Last month, Hazen asked the Bedford Board of Zoning Appeals to approve a variance from the zoning code so she can operate the vintage resale shop there.

That request was denied.

Herthel asked the Bedford Plan Commission to consider changing the zoning. After some debate, commission members agreed to move the request on to a public hearing. That hearing will be scheduled for a future plan commission meeting.
